In Emigsville, PA, the municipal sewer systems are designed to handle water, not heavy solids or congealed fats. A grease trap works by slowing down the flow of warm, greasy water from your sinks and dishwashers. As the water cools, the grease floats to the top, and solids sink to the bottom. Only the "clean" water in the middle should escape into the Emigsville sewer lines.

The core of our service in Emigsville is a thorough pump-out. We don't just skim the top; we evacuate the entire contents of the tank. Our high-powered vacuum trucks are equipped to handle any size interceptor found in Emigsville, PA, from small under-sink units to massive 2,000-gallon outdoor tanks.
Pumping the tank is only half the battle. The lines leading to and from your grease trap in Emigsville often have a thick coating of congealed fat. We use specialized hydro-jetting equipment—using high-pressure water streams—to scour the interior of your pipes, restoring them to like-new flow conditions.
A grease trap is only effective if its internal components are intact. During every visit to your Emigsville location, our technicians inspect the "baffles"—the internal walls that direct water flow. If these are corroded or broken, the trap fails. We provide on-the-spot assessments to ensure your hardware is functional.

Navigating the legal landscape of grease management in Emigsville can be daunting. The local authorities require that commercial kitchens maintain a grease trap that is sized correctly for their volume and cleaned at a frequency that prevents "slugs" of grease from entering the wastewater system.
Typically, the "25% Rule" applies in Emigsville. This means that once your trap is 25% full of solids and grease combined, it must be pumped.
